  • Page 3 SETTING THE WIDTH OF THE BACKREST The baby is comfortable when the backrest supports the whole length of their thighs. With the smallest babies you should adjust the width to the narrowest position. Undo the studs on both sides of the black belt around the waist and move them to the center as far as possible.

    PULLING UP THE LEGS Before you start wearing the carrier, it’s important to shorten the straps on the sides of the backrest. These straps are not easy to tighten; this prevents them from loosening over time which would cause the baby or toddler’s legs to gradually drop lower.

  • Page 6 SAFETY It is very important that the waist belt buckle is securely locked so that it cannot come undone while wearing your baby. Never unlock your waist belt while the baby is still in the carrier! When you want to finish wearing your baby, first remove the baby from the carrier and only after that take off the carrier itself.

    Can I wear my baby facing forward? No. KiBi is designed to conform with modern-day paediatric knowledge and is designed so that the baby is facing the carrying person. Small babies who cannot sit on their own and cannot walk do not have sufficiently developed muscles along the spine to fully support their own body weight.

  • Page 19 – CHECKLIST Main points for carrier adjustment You have just received the KiBi adjustable and ergonomic baby carrier, which is set to the largest size, i.e. for a child around the age of three. It is therefore necessary to adjust it before wearing the carrier for the first time based on the size of the child you plan to carry.
  • Page 20 Soft structured baby carrier KiBi EVO CARE Can be machine washed at 30°C on a gentle cycle. Fasten all buckles before washing. It’s recommended to set up the baby carrier to its largest size. Wash using a gentle detergent for coloured laundry, spin at 400 RPM (or as low as possible).
